Log Haven is where the reception and wedding took place and they gave Charlie this adorable dog bowl to drink out of during the reception. I thought that was so thoughtful and grand. Log Haven does a splendid summer offer called the "Dog Days of Summer"

Enjoy a hike in Millcreek Canyon with Fido and then stop in for dinner at Log Haven. Diners with well-behaved canine companions will be seated in Log Haven’s spectacular outdoor amphitheater, where they can order from Log Haven’s seasonal menu. A limited-time drink menu will be offered in honor of Dog Days and will include items such as Chateau Le Paws wine (from Rosenblum), the Sober Dover, the Melon Collie Mojito, and the Salty Chihuahua, a cocktail made from a special blend of grapefruit juice, Anejo Tequila and Agave nectar.

Going to the Chapel and I'm Gonna Get Married

Charlie and I will be flying to Utah this Friday to attend the wedding of our dear friends Sam and Anna. I figure that since Charlie will be the only dog at the ceremony, he should look like he dressed up for the occasion. My friend's wedding colors are light pink, fuchsia, beige and sage green. I found this light pink ribbon in my craft supplies and rigged him up a bow tie.
I adjusted the size of the bowtie by folding the ribbon over so it was snug on Charlie's neck and then fastened the ribbon together with these scrapbook brads.
